Planting Calendar for Bloodleaf

Frost tolerance for bloodleaf: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ost has passed.

Since bloodleaf require warm weather it is necessary to wait until after all chance of fr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ant bloodleaf in Mission Viejo is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ant bloodleaf and expect a good harvest is probably September. Any later than that and your bloodleaf may not have a chance to fully mature. You can get started a little bit earlier by starting your bloodleaf indoors.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ost has passed is on January 31 in Mission Viejo. You can expect an average low temperature of 35°F in the coldest months of winter.

Remember that the actual date of last frost is just an average because it is based on the USDA zone info for Mission Viejo and it will vary from year to year. Half of the time in Mission Viejo last frost occurs after January 31 so be sure to be ready to cover your bloodleaf if you have a late frost.
